基于“树根”锚固作用的超支化聚氨酯改性浸渍纸饰面细木工板的界面强化研究

Interface reinforcement study of hyperbranched polyurethane-modified impregnated paper decorated blockboard based on the “root” anchoring effect

  • 摘要: 浸渍胶膜纸饰面细木工板作为人造板室内家具装饰材料的一种,因基材尺寸稳定性差及与浸渍纸界面结合力弱易产生表面龟裂。针对这一问题,本研究通过合成了一种端氨基超支化聚合物(HBP-NH2),并与水性异氰酸酯复合制备了复合改性剂(MD-HBP-NH2),研究其对浸渍纸和细木工板的界面强化机制。结果表明:(1)复合改性剂与三聚氰胺-甲醛浸渍树脂混合后,对浸渍胶黏剂的固化时间无显著影响,改性后浸渍纸的抗张强度保持在6.11 kN/m,但伸长率提升至0.62%;2)将复合改性剂涂覆于细木工板表面,改性后细木工板表面的水接触角达94.16°,表面自由能与热压后浸渍纸接近,干热条件下尺寸变化率较天然木材显著降低52.3%,饰面细木工板的胶合强度提升至1.24 MPa,耐冷热循环和耐龟裂性能均达到5级;3)通过界面分析表明,复合改性剂通过物理化学键合渗透入浸渍纸和细木工板表面木材内,形成“树根状”增强网络,从而显著提高了浸渍纸与细木工板的界面结合力。本研究通过分子改性设计与界面强化,显著提升了浸渍胶膜纸饰面细木工板的界面结合强度、耐水性和尺寸稳定性,有效防止了饰面细木工板表面龟裂现象产生。

     

    Abstract: Surface decorated blockboard with paper impregnated thermosetting resins, as a type of wood-based panel used for indoor furniture decoration, is prone to surface cracking due to the poor dimensional stability of its substrate and weak interfacial bonding strength with the impregnated paper. To address this issue, this study synthesized an amino-terminated hyperbranched polymer (HBP-NH2) and compounded it with a waterborne isocyanate to prepare a composite modifier (MD-HBP-NH2), investigating its mechanism for interfacial reinforcement between the impregnated paper and blockboard. The results show that: (1) After mixing the composite modifier with melamine-formaldehyde (MF) impregnation resin, it had no significant effect on the curing time of the impregnation adhesive. The modified impregnated paper maintained a tensile strength of 6.11 kN/m, while its elongation increased to 0.62%. (2) Applying the composite modifier to the blockboard surface resulted in a water contact angle of 94.16°, surface free energy close to that of the hot-pressed impregnated paper, a 52.3% significant reduction in dimensional change rate under dry-heat conditions compared to natural wood, and an increased bonding strength of the decorated blockboard to 1.24 MPa. Both cold-hot cycle resistance and crack resistance reached grade 5. (3) Interfacial analysis revealed that the composite modifier penetrated the impregnated paper and the wood surface of the blockboard through physicochemical bonding, forming a "root-like" reinforcement network. This significantly enhanced the interfacial bonding strength between the impregnated paper and the blockboard. Through molecular modification design and interfacial reinforcement, this study significantly improved the interfacial bonding strength, water resistance, and dimensional stability of surface decorated blockboard with paper impregnated thermosetting resins, effectively preventing surface cracking phenomena.
